I was looking for a quality classical guitar for my 10 year old daughter who has been playing for 2 years and has progressed well beyond the $120 Fender Classical that she began with. Based on her solid progression at a professional music school, I was fully prepared to go to the $800 to $1200 range as that seemed to be the next meaningful quality level without going crazy. However, her instructor; herself a music major, performer and full time instructor, suggested the Cordoba Cadete after another student bought one.She said she was "amazed" at the sound quality and the way the sound projected from a guitar at this price point. She also liked the construction quality and felt it easily compared to other guitars in the $800-1000 level. Furthermore, she felt my daughter could get 2-3 years out of this level of guitar before we need to upgrade. It would then be likely that we would progress to the $1500-3000 range if my daughter's progress/interest continues. I was skeptical but was happy to save money if the Cadete would do the trick.I also called around, and ended up speaking to two luthiers who make high end guitars. They did not know this particular guitar as they make custom high end instruments. But, they did feel that a step to the $1000 level does not buy a huge upgrade from the $200-300 level.Well, we are extremely satisfied with the sound, build quality, and the beauty of the instrument for just over $200. It is a huge upgrade from the starter Fender which was not a bad starter. The Cordoba sound is reasonably comparable to the instructor's $1400 classical - in the instructor's opinion.I thought this was a great buy, especially when you consider the quality balanced against the possibility that a young student could end up losing interest in guitar. The only negative is that it does not include a case, but at this price point you would get a cheap one if it was included. So I would recommend buying a decent quality padded gig bag or hard case.I fully believe I could resell the Cordoba 3 years from now for $90-125, thereby making this an even better value. I would highly recommend this instrument.

Great guitar for players with smaller hands. Surprised by the tone. Wish the guitar fit me better.
Pros: good construction, great sound for the price and size, good size for smaller players, very playable out of the box with barely any adjustment required out of the box.Cons: not very comfortable for a player with longer fingers or larger hands, a little awkward to hold due to the smaller size. None of these cons are worth taking any stars off my rating of the guitar.I played around on this guitar for a month or so and loved the sound. I was a little surprised with some of the tones that it was able to produce for a smaller frame. Good sustain, not great. I had a hard time, being a newer nylon player, finding a decent balance balance between the lower and higher strings BUT I will attribute that to my ability as a player rather than the guitar.Ultimately I decided to ship it back and my justification for doing so is solely because of its size. I was very impressed with the sound and tone out of this guitar, but for someone with large hands and long fingers, it was just not comfortable to want to keep. I will order a Córdoba C5 limited after shopping around for some time. As far as brands go, Córdoba seems to have more to offer for my price point.

Good sound, had issues
Guitar is beautiful wood finish with good depth of sound. Mine came with fret edges that were sharp enough to cut fingers. This is due to the lack of humidity in our climate, causing the rosewood neck to shrink. I could have returned it and risked the same issue again and again. I wrote Cordoba and have yet to receive response, the reason for my rating. A simple inexpensive humidifier kit solves many humidity issues, but not those as severe as mine.I looked up a good guitar tech who filed down the fret edges to a comfortable playable feel and also stretched the strings to help maintain tuning, a $50 service, well worth the effort.

Excellent little guitar
I really like this little Cordoba. It fits me and my hands well. I'm 5'9" with medium sized hands. I mainly play steel string acoustic guitar, just getting into playing classical guitar. I like the width of the neck, it fits my hand well. I normally play a Martin with high performance neck, this is not a significant change from what I'm used too. Most classical guitars have a 2" or wider neck, and feel too large in my hands, this 3/4 size Cordoba is a perfect for me.The sound quality is excellent for the price, it doesn't sound as good as a guitar costing $2k, but it's no where near that price. It sounds really excellent compared to other guitars in this price range, I think it sounds better than every Yamaha I've tested below $500. Everyone's ear is different, so I'd suggest taking a listen at a local shop if you can find it. I looked at several local retailers (4 different Guitar centers and a Sam Ash) but was unable to find it. I listened to several YouTube videos of the guitar and decided to take the plunge without hearing it in person first.I'm very happy with the purchase.
